Average proportion of Mountain Key Biodiversity Areas (KBAs) covered in Angola
Angola: Average proportion of Mountain Key Biodiversity Areas (KBAs) covered was 9.8% in 2025. ▬ Flat
Average proportion of Mountain Key Biodiversity Areas (KBAs) covered in Angola, 2000–2025
Source: United Nations Statistics Division, SDG Global Database.
Analysis
The most recent figure for average proportion of mountain key biodiversity areas (kbas) covered in Angola is 9.8%, measured in 2025. That is the highest value across all 26 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is unchanged over ten years.
Over the whole period, average proportion of mountain key biodiversity areas (kbas) covered in Angola peaked at 9.8% in 2000 and was at its lowest, 9.8%, in 2000.
That places Angola 147th out of 167 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the bottom quarter.
